History of Universiti Sultan Zainal Abidin

Universiti Sultan Zainal Abidin (UniSZA) started as Kolej Ugama Sultan Zainal Abidin (KUSZA). KUSZA commenced operation on 1st January 1980 at Batu Burok before moving to Hajah Wook Building in Pulau Kambing in 1981.

KUSZA was upgraded to a university status and became Universiti Darul Iman (UDM). UDM underwent a rebranding process on 14th May 2010 and became known as Universiti Sultan Zainal Abidin (UniSZA). The name of the late Sultan Zainal Abidin III Muazzam Shah ibni Almarhum Sultan Ahmad Muazzam Shah II, Sultan The 11th Terengganu is adopted to honor the services of His Majesty in spreading knowledge and religion in the state of Terengganu.

On 29th November 2013, a new UniSZA logo was introduced. UniSZA currently operates in three campuses, namely the Gong Badak Campus (Kuala Nerus) as the main campus, Medical Campus (Kuala Terengganu), and Besut Campus, as well as operating a satellite office in Putrajaya.

Leadership - KUSZA-UDM-UniSZA

Dr. Wan Shamsuddin bin Wan Mamat

Director of KUSZA

13th July 1981 - 19th March 1987

Prof. Dr. Hamid bin Abdullah

Director of KUSZA

1st Nov 1987 - 31st Dec 1990

Dato' Dr. Ahmad Ibrahim bin Shukri

Director of KUSZA

1st May 1991 - 31st Dec 1997

Ustaz Che Ismail bin Abdul Halim

Director of KUSZA

1st June 1998 - 31st July 2002

Prof. Madya Dr. Amat @ Anwar bin Zainal Abidin

Director of KUSZA

1st Sep 2002 - 26th Mar 2004

Prof. Dr. Ahmad Shukri bin Yazid

Director of KUSZA

2004 - 2005

Dato Prof. Dr. Alias bin Daud

Vice Chancellor of UDM and UniSZA

1st Jan 2006 - 31st Dec 2012

Prof. Datuk Dr. Yahaya bin Ibrahim

Prof. Datuk Dr. Yahaya bin Ibrahim Vice Chancellor of UniSZA

1st Jan 2013 - 31st Dec 2015

Prof. Dato' Dr. Ahmad Zubaidi bin A. Latif

Vice Chancellor of UniSZA

1st Feb 2016 - 31st Jan 2019

Prof. Dato' Dr. Hassan Basri bin Awang Mat Dahan

Vice Chancellor of UniSZA

1st Feb 2019 - 2022

Prof. Dato’ Dr. Fadzli bin Adam

Vice Chancellor of UniSZA

1 Mar 2022 - Current
